About The Position

As a Data Scientist at Verily, you will be supporting our core mission to drive innovation in evidence generation for research and care decisions. We are building new types of longitudinal datasets that have foundations of RWD sources, such as EHRs (electronic health records) and claims data, and are augmented with prospective data collection. You will develop and deploy models that enable scalable curation of RWD. This will include multi-source integrations and reconciliations, creating derived features from the source data (e.g., abstraction of clinical concepts from unstructured data), and facilitating data quality assessments. You will work with a diverse cross-functional team to build reusable and scalable tools and to deliver products that unlock information from structured and unstructured clinical data.
